ANABA, VANGUARD EDITOR BECOMES NEW PRESIDENT OF NIGERIAN GUILD OF EDITORS
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

The Guild of Editors Conference and Convention in Owerri, Imo State has produced Mr. Eze ANABA, Editor of Vanguard Newspaper as the new President of the Guild, where Husseina Bangshika emerged as Deputy President

Anaba rose through the ranks in the Vanguard and has done almost every editorial job at the newspaper organization. These include working as Law and Human Rights Editor, Deputy News Editor, Saturday Editor, and Deputy Editor.

He has a Master’s in Communication Studies from the prestigious Leicester University, United Kingdom.
He has served in two Federal Government-appointed committees: the Law Reform Committee during President Olusegun Obasanjo’s Administration and the Committee on the Abrogation of Death Penalty in Nigeria.

He is also a leading member of the civil society movement in the country.

Over the years, Anaba has deployed the expertise and experiences from these positions and networks to promote and advance media freedom and diversity in the country

Also elected were Umoru Ibrahim, VP North, Kabir Alabi Garba, VP West, Sheddy Ozoene, VP East, Iyobosa Uwugiaren, General Secretary, Gabriel Akinadewo, Assistant General Secretary, Steve Nwosu, Treasurer, and Charles Kalu, Social/Publicity Secretary.

The following were elected into the Standing C’ttee: Paulyn Ugbodaga and Muhammad S. Jibrin (North), Onuoha Ukeh, Oluwole Sogunle and Rose Moses (West) and Chinedu Egere and Dom Isute (East). They will serve for a period of 2 years.

The past Presidents of the Guild include:

1. Lateef Jakande (1961-1970)
2. Alade Odunewu (1970-1972)
3. Horatio Agedah (1973-1975)
4. Turi Muhammad (1975-1976)
5. Tony Momoh (1976-1978)
6. Chris Okolie (1978-1982)
7. Mohammed Ibrahim (1982-1983)
8. Onyema Ugochukwu (1988-1990)
9. Wada Maida (1990-1992)
10. Biodun Oduwole (1993-1995)
11. Garba Shehu (1996-1998)
12. Remi Oyo (1998-2003)
13. Haliru Dantiye (2003-2007)
14. Gbenga Adefaye (2008-2012)
15. Femi Adesina (2013-2015)
16. Garbadeen Muhammad (2015-2016)
17. Funke Egbemode (2016-2019)
18. Isa Mustapha (2019-2023).

Bolaji Adebiyi, his main opponent in the contest has also accepted the outcome and congratulated ANABA and all winners who emerged for the various positions in the election.
